Featuring a cast of Irish actors including Charlene Mc Kenna (Raw, Whistleblower), Garrett Lombard (Rough Diamond, Love Is A Drug), Dawn Bradfield (The Clinic), Gail Fitzpatrick (Strength and Honour), Orla Fitzgerald (The Wind that Shakes the Barley), Liam Carney (Speed Dating) and many more besides, the original series gained critical and commercial success when the final episode of the first series culminated with an audience of 437,000.
New faces joining the cast will be J.J Feild (Blood The Last Vampire, Goal) and Diarmuid Noynes (Five Minutes of Heaven, Prosperity)
The drama, which has five IFTA’s under its belt from the first series including Best Director and Best Actress, will be shooting for four weeks in Birr town and the surrounding areas. Director of Photography is Owen Mc Polin (The Take), whilst editor of the series will be Isobel Stephenson.

RTÉ Television will repeat the original six part series of ‘Pure Mule’ on RTÉ One in late July in order to give viewers a chance to see the whole series again before the new episodes.
